Finance Review Summary — Licensing Dispute

The dispute with Calderbay Systems over the Vexon toolkit licence remains unresolved. Counsel estimates exposure between 80k and 140k if arbitration proceeds. We have reserved accordingly and paused renewals on adjacent Calderbay products. Sales leads should avoid committing Vexon-dependent features in new proposals. How this affects our roadmap is covered in the confidential note below.

management briefing: Project Ulavan slips by two quarters because of the staffing delay.

Subject: Key rotation for InvoiceForge renderer

Welcome, new folks. Every quarter we rotate the credential the Pellworth PDF invoice renderer uses to call our internal asset service, Vaultline. The old key stops working Friday at noon. Update your local .env and the staging config before then, and verify a test invoice renders with the new embedded fonts. For convenience, the freshly issued key is included here.

app token of bagef-bageg = kto11_vuwA0uhrEMg

The SheetVault export endpoint streams rows in fixed 4 MB chunks to keep worker memory flat regardless of spreadsheet size; no full-document buffering occurs server-side. Peak resident memory is bounded at roughly 60 MB per export job. All requests must authenticate against the internal GridRelay gateway using the service key provided below.

app token of kafop-hahaf = kto11_iRLdsMBafGn

## Tallow Engine — Environments

The Tallow formula service evaluates user-supplied expressions inside a locked sandbox on every environment tier. Plugin authors should note that the sandbox in `dev` is deliberately permissive for debugging, while `staging` and `prod` enforce strict instruction budgets, memory ceilings, and a denylist of host calls. Formulas that pass in dev may still be rejected upstream, so always test against staging before release. Each tier's sandbox is governed by the following configuration values.

settings of fafog-haduf:
ZORIX_PIN=4648
ZORIX_METRICS_HOST=metrics.zorix.paliqsys.corp
ZORIX_LOG_LEVEL=info
ZORIX_TENANT=druix